Hi Sam,

First, TECK doesn't give a "......" about you, your mother, your broker, your friends et al.

TECK are in this "small financial" play to discover new orebodies, nothing more, nothing less. They have hungry integrated mills/smelters/refineries etc to be fed.

Let me give you a broad trivial statistic; approx one in one thousand discoveries "may" result in a mine being established. TECK stays in touch with the juniors (and invests in) because they are more cost effective in terms of finding an economic orebody than the majors.

The reason is simple enough, investors don't mind losing their money, TECK does.

regards, Terence Mitchell

PS. In the past, I've done projects for TECK. Quite simply, they are in the Mining business to make money. Their investment in SVB is just one of many strategic investments around the world to ensure future concentrate supplies to feed the principle infrastructure investments in place. TECK will be anywhere that the smell of base metals, precious metals, energy sources etc, etc, etc occur.
